How Much Does It Cost to Tune a Bow?

If you are a beginner archer, or just getting started in the sport, you may be wondering how much it costs to tune a bow. The cost of tuning a bow can vary depending on the type of bow and the complexity of the tune. For example, a simple recurve bow can be tuned for less than $20, while a compound bow may cost upwards of $100 to tune.

The most important factor in determining the cost of tuning a bow is the type of bow you have. A recurve bow is the simplest and most common type ofbow; as such, it is also the least expensive to tune. A compound bow is more complex, with pulleys and cables that must be properly aligned; this increases both the time and cost required for a proper tune.

Finally, an Olympic recurvebow is even more complex than a compound bow; as such, it generally costs more to have one tuned. In addition to the type of bow, another factor that affects the cost of tuning is whether or not you need an expert to do it for you. If you are comfortable working with your hands and have some knowledge about bows, then you can probably save money by tuning your ownbow.

However, if you are unsure about your abilities or simply don’t have the time, then it will likely be worth paying someone else to do it for you. Either way, make sure that whoever tunes yourbow knows what they’re doing; a poorly-tuned bow can adversely affect your shooting accuracy and performance.

Compound Bow Bass Pro

A compound bow is a type of bow that uses a system of pulleys and cables to bend the limbs. This makes it much easier to draw the bow than with a traditional recurve or longbow. Compound bows are also much more powerful, making them perfect for hunting big game animals.
